What does the waterproof rating and breathability mean for an Outdoor Research waterproof rain jacket, and how should I read the specs?
Waterproof rating indicates how much water the fabric can resist before it leaks in, usually described by a water column or equivalent standard; higher numbers mean better protection. Breathability, often shown as MVTR, measures how quickly moisture vapor escapes from inside, with higher values reducing clamminess during activity. When choosing, balance protection with comfort: a jacket from Outdoor Research may use a durable membrane or laminate, and look for taped seams and a durable water-repellent finish to maximize performance.

How should I care for and maintain an Outdoor Research waterproof rain jacket to keep it performing well?
Follow the care label and wash with a mild detergent to remove oils and dirt, then reproof with a DWR spray or wash-in product to restore water beading. Avoid fabric softeners and high-heat drying; close zippers and Velcro before washing, and air dry or tumble dry on low if allowed. Store the jacket clean and dry, inspect seams and zippers regularly, and reproof as needed to extend life and maintain waterproof performance.
What size and fit considerations should I keep in mind when selecting an Outdoor Research waterproof rain jacket?
Choose a size that allows a warm layer underneath without restricting movement; look for a regular or semi-relaxed fit if you plan to layer, or a trim fit if you want minimal bulk. Check sleeve length, shoulder mobility, and hood compatibility with your helmet or cap. Use the size chart and try on with the gear you’ll wear beneath; if possible, test the jacket in a light drizzle to gauge comfort and coverage.
